WebDec 14, 2024 · Here is a list of the surviving Kirk session records for this parish: Crathie. The Kirk Session records for Crathie can be viewed on FS Library Film 0993177 (see Established Church - Old Parish Registers above). Braemer, Kindrochet. The Kirk Session records have been digitised but are not currently available online.

There are two grave yards side by side. John Brown is buried in the one with the Kirk ruins, which dates back to pre reformation. When facing John Browns grave stone, look to your left and over the wall.
